What a weekend at Taupō! Two races, a podium, and a cyclone - not your average Supercars round. Really stoked with how the Mobil 1 Optus Supra performed and we came away with some really positive momentum. 

We qualified P7 for the opening race and I felt really good off the start, moving up to P5 in the opening laps. The car had a strong pace early and we were managing the tyres well through the stint. We pitted on lap 18 for four new tyres and rejoined in around P4 which was a solid spot to be in. 

The final stint was a bit trickier - the tyre life started working against us late in the race and we dropped back to finish P7. Not the result we wanted but we learned a lot heading into the feature race. 

Race 9 was a lot of fun. Qualified sixth and got a great launch off the line, working my way up to fifth in the opening laps. The first stint was really intense and I was pushing hard the whole way through. After pitting on lap 23, I think I got a bit of a telling off from Scaff over the radio after I told him I was going to drive this thing hard and fast! 

Overtook De Pasquale for fifth and kept pushing, getting myself up to third before the final stop. We came out in a great spot in P2, had a big battle with Broc then took the chequered flag in P3. 

Really satisfying to be on the podium and great to be rewarded for the work the whole team has been putting in. 

Unfortunately Sunday's Race 10 was cancelled with Cyclone Vaianu closing in on the Waikato region - the right call by Supercars and the safety of everyone in New Zealand comes first. 

The race gets rescheduled to Friday in Christchurch which means a big four-race weekend is coming up. 

The team has climbed from P6 to P2 in the Teams' Championship this weekend which is a massive result for everyone who has put so much work in behind the scenes.
